Description

Why Join CI² Aviation? This role offers a unique pathway into air traffic control through a structured development program aligned with FAA workforce initiatives. Candidates will receive formal training, milestone-based progression opportunities, and the chance to build a long-term career in aviation operations. Position Summary CI² Aviation is seeking motivated individuals to join our team as Developmental Air Traffic Controllers (ATC Trainees) in support of the Federal Aviation Administration workforce development initiative. This role is designed for individuals pursuing certification as a Contract Tower Operator (CTO) and provides structured training to prepare candidates for operational responsibilities in FAA contract tower environments. Developmental Controllers will complete classroom instruction, on-the-job training, and milestone-based certifications while working toward full Local Control certification and successful completion of the CTO exam. Candidates must successfully complete all required training milestones within 6–12 months of hire, unless otherwise approved by the FAA.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Training & Development Participate in structured classroom training covering area knowledge, local procedures, and facility-specific operations. Complete assigned Individual Training Plan (ITP) requirements. Successfully progress through required training milestones. Participate in on-the-job training with certified instructors. Maintain training documentation and demonstrate proficiency throughout each phase of training. Prepare for and complete the Contract Tower Operator (CTO) certification exam. Air Traffic Control Responsibilities Assist in managing the safe, orderly, and efficient movement of aircraft in designated airspace. Learn and apply FAA regulations, procedures, and operational requirements. Provide aircraft instructions related to: Ground movement Clearance delivery Takeoffs Landings Monitor weather conditions and communicate relevant updates to pilots. Maintain accurate operational logs and documentation. Support operational safety standards within contract tower facilities. Compliance & Reporting Adhere to all FAA operational procedures and safety requirements. Maintain training records required for FAA reporting. Support documentation related to milestone completion. Follow company and FAA compliance requirements throughout training.
